Yikes!  I don't think I've ever seen anyone use IE
installed on their native windows partition.  I think
the only recommended (and as you can see, "safe")
method is to install IE on your fake wine c drive.

That said, while I love Wine, I wouldn't ever trust it
to run something on off a real windows drive.
